1. Chinese Egg Rice

This Chinese dish has a very original and interesting taste. It is perfect as hearty lunch or dinner.

Ingredients:

  • 150 g rice
  • 3 eggs
  • 2 garlic cloves
  • 5 onions
  • 2 tbsp. l. vegetable oil
  • 125 g green peas
  • 1 st. l. soy sauce

Cooking method:

  • Boil rice for 10-12 minutes. It should be almost ready, but not quite soft. Drain the water and rinse the rice under cold water.
  • Put the eggs in the saucepan. Whisk a little and put on small fire. Heat, stirring, until they thicken slightly.
  • Heat the oil in a large wok or deep skillet. Add crushed garlic, finely chopped onion, boiled peas and fry, stirring occasionally, 1-2 minutes.
  • Add rice to wok, stir.
  • Add eggs soy sauce and a pinch of salt. Stir.
  • Arrange on plates and serve.

2. Asian noodle and shrimp salad

This salad is a great solution for the case when there is no time to cook, but you want to have a delicious lunch.

Ingredients:

  • 600 g thin noodles
  • 1 kg shrimp (cooked)
  • 1 bunch radish
  • 1 bunch basil
  • 150 ml sweet soy sauce
  • salt pepper
  • olive oil

Cooking method:

  • Place the noodles in a heatproof bowl. Pour boiling water, salt, pepper and leave for 5 minutes or until tender.
  • Transfer the noodles to a large bowl. Add shrimp, chopped radish, basil, a little olive oil and mix gently.
  • Divide salad among bowls. Drizzle with soy sauce and serve immediately.

8. Chicken Breasts with Honey and Sesame

Honey and sesame seeds are a great addition to chicken. Such bold combinations can often be found in Asian cuisine.

Ingredients:

  • 500 g chicken breasts
  • 4 tbsp. l. soy sauce
  • 2 tbsp. l. honey
  • vegetable oil
  • 4 garlic cloves
  • ground black pepper
  • curry
  • ground ginger

Cooking method:

  • Rinse the chicken breasts thoroughly, cut into portions. Salt, season with pepper, ginger and curry. Add soy sauce.
  • Squeeze out the garlic with a garlic press. Add to breasts.
  • Thoroughly mix the breasts with all the seasonings, leave to marinate for 1 hour.
  • Heat vegetable oil in a frying pan and add honey. Wait for the honey to melt and gently mix it with vegetable oil so that it is distributed throughout the pan.
  • Place chicken breasts in skillet and cook over low heat until tender. golden brown from two sides.
  • At the end, sprinkle with a handful of sesame seeds, mix. Remove from heat after a couple of minutes.

12. tom yum kung

To appreciate the Thai flavor, it is not at all necessary to go to another country. Just cook this national soup.

Ingredients:

  • 300 ml coconut milk
  • 300 ml fish broth
  • 5 lemongrass leaves
  • 5 kaffir lime leaves
  • ginger root
  • 1 chili pepper
  • 10 shrimp
  • cilantro
  • 4 shiitake mushrooms
  • 1 st. l. fish sauce
  • 1/2 tsp brown sugar
  • 3 garlic cloves
  • 1 st. l. vegetable oil
  • 1/2 tsp sesame oil
  • 1 lime

Cooking method:

  • Boil shiitake and shrimp until tender.
  • Finely chop the lemongrass and kaffir lime leaves, garlic, pepper and ginger.
  • Fry garlic and pepper in hot vegetable and sesame oil for 1 minute. Then crush them with a mortar.
  • Pour into the saucepan coconut milk and broth. Bring to a boil. Dip the lemongrass, ginger and kaffir lime leaves into the soup.
  • Then add the garlic-pepper mixture and cook for 1-2 minutes.
  • Pour in fish sauce. Add chopped mushrooms and cook for 2 more minutes.
  • Add lime juice and sugar. Stir gently.
  • Put the shrimp into the soup, remove the soup from the heat.
  • Sprinkle with chopped cilantro before serving.

14. Beef with basil

beef in thai style usually served with rice. special taste This dish adds fragrant basil.

Ingredients (this recipe makes 2 servings):

  • 240 g beef tenderloin
  • 15 g lemongrass
  • 1 lime
  • 1 garlic clove
  • cilantro
  • green onion
  • 1 chili pepper
  • basil
  • 10 g oyster sauce
  • 25 g fish sauce
  • 10 g soy sauce
  • 100 g chicken broth
  • cane sugar
  • 10 g cornstarch
  • 160 g jasmine rice
  • olive oil

Cooking method:

  • Pour rice with cold water in a ratio of 1/1.5, bring to a boil, cover and cook over moderate heat until the water has completely evaporated (6-7 minutes).
  • Crush and coarsely chop the lemongrass. Cut the beef into thin slices and marinate with lemongrass, soy sauce and 1/2 starch, mix.
  • Peel, crush and finely chop the garlic, mash it to a paste. Cut and finely chop 2 thin sheets of chili pepper, mix with garlic. Add the fish sauce, 1/4 lime juice and sugar to the garlic paste.
  • Coarsely chop the green onion. Dissolve remaining starch in chicken broth.
  • Remove the lemongrass and fry the beef over high heat in olive oil for 2 minutes, stirring constantly, pour in the sauce and starch, add the oyster sauce, bring to a boil.
  • Add onion and basil, stir and remove from heat.
  • Arrange the beef and vegetables on the rice, sprinkle with finely chopped cilantro and serve.

15. Bananas in batter

V Chinese cuisine there is a dessert popular all over the world - battered bananas. This dish is traditionally used rice flour. This makes the dough very soft.

Ingredients:

  • 3 medium bananas
  • 100 g rice flour
  • 50 g powdered sugar
  • 100 ml carbonated mineral water
  • 2 tbsp. l. peanut butter

Cooking method:

  • Pour the flour into a deep bowl, slowly add sparkling water and knead the dough, resembling low-fat sour cream in consistency.
  • Peel bananas, cut either lengthwise in half or across into 3 parts. Dipping bananas in batter, fry on a preheated peanut butter a few minutes on each side until golden brown.
  • Sprinkle fried bananas generously with powdered sugar.

Simply put, yaki-soba is fried noodles. The dish is very common in Asian countries and very popular in Japan. It is sold in tents, during all kinds of festivities, it is cooked at home when you need to do something quickly and tasty. She is loved by children, teenagers and adults. Try and cook this popular and very simple dish of everyday Japanese cuisine.

First we need a special sauce. In Japan, it is usually sold in grocery supermarkets, but its analogue can also be prepared at home from quite affordable ingredients.

To prepare the sauce, you just need to mix all the ingredients for the sauce.

In Japan, yaki-soba is used wheat noodles"main", which tastes like ours homemade noodles, and in appearance - instant noodles from bags, such as doshirak. So, for this purpose, you can take ordinary domestic-made noodles with a low protein content for this purpose and boil until fully prepared in salted water.

This set of products is enough for 2 good servings of noodles.
So, we cut the onion into thin half rings, and the cabbage into fairly large pieces. Meat for yaki soba must be cut very thin so that it can be fried in seconds.

Fry the onion until transparent. Fry cabbage with onion until soft.


Add meat and fry until nice golden brown.


Add soy sprouts, if any. We mix.


Add noodles, mix everything thoroughly and fry a little.


Pour all the sauce into the skillet at once and mix well. We wait until the excess liquid has evaporated and turn off the fire.
